About The Organisation
Here at NHS Lanarkshire, we put the patient at the heart of everything we do. Each colleague within the organisation plays a key role in how we deliver our healthcare services.
We proudly serve a population of 655,000 across rural and urban communities in both North and South Lanarkshire. NHS Lanarkshire is comprised of Acute Services (which currently provide hospital based services over 3 main sites), Corporate & Property & Support Services, North and South Lanarkshire Health and Social Care Partnerships which provide integrated primary healthcare and social care services to local communities and surrounding areas.
The Role
Provide domestic service to patients, staff and visitors of NHS Lanarkshire, (NHSL) premises through the use of effective and efficient methods, which deliver a ‘safe’ and welcoming environment and meet the required NHSL and Hospital Acquired Infections (HAI )standards.
To work alongside and support new staff in the working environment
The working pattern for this role is Monday/Friday 16.45-20.00
In this key role, you will:
- Undertake a range of cleaning tasks which require the use of machinery, equipment and cleaning appliances involving manual handling and lifting
- To ensure all cleaning is undertaken to the required standards and report to supervisor any areas not cleaned due to access issues etc
- Utilise cleaning materials and agents in keeping with Health & Safety responsibilities and Control of Substances Hazardous to Health (COSHH) guidelines.
- Ensure the safety and consideration of patients, staff and visitors at all times whilst performing tasks.
What You'll Bring:
- Knowledge of cleaning standards and related procedures.
- Working knowledge Health & Safety including participation in risk assessing individual tasks
- Ability to work with people and as part of a multidisciplinary team.
- Ability to carry out assigned tasks effectively and efficiently in a busy environment.
